WebMar 29, 2024 · The Institute of Contemporary Art Boston announced Cicely Carew, Venetia Dale, and Yu-Wen Wu as the recipients of the 2024 James and Audrey Foster Prize on … WebCicely Carew (b. Los Angeles, CA in 1982, lives and works in Boston, MA) animates the tools and scale of printmaking with the assertion “color is corporal.” Moving from two dimensions to three by layering not just imagery but materials, she occupies and energizes space with vibrancy, which she asserts as a Black woman, is a political act.

WebJan 19, 2024 · Cicely Carew. Boston-based, L.A.-bred Cicely Carew’s multimedia works comprise an ecosystem of possibility. With rebellious mark-making, vibrant color, and sweeping gestures, Carew captures the momentary magic of her process to build enduring spaces of radical joy and liberation.
